New ‘persona vectors’ from Anthropic allow you to decode and direct an LLM’s persona

A new examine from the Anthropic Fellows Program reveals a way to determine, monitor and management character traits in massive language fashions (LLMs). The findings present that fashions can develop undesirable personalities (e.g., changing into malicious, excessively agreeable, or inclined to creating issues up) both in response to person prompts or as an unintended consequence of coaching. 

The researchers introduce “persona vectors,” that are instructions in a mannequin’s inner activation area that correspond to particular persona traits, offering a toolkit for builders to handle the habits of their AI assistants higher.

Mannequin personas can go unsuitable

LLMs usually work together with customers by way of an “Assistant” persona designed to be useful, innocent, and trustworthy. Nevertheless, these personas can fluctuate in sudden methods. At deployment, a mannequin’s persona can shift dramatically primarily based on prompts or conversational context, as seen when Microsoft’s Bing chatbot threatened customers or xAI’s Grok began behaving erratically. Because the researchers notice of their paper, “Whereas these specific examples gained widespread public consideration, most language fashions are vulnerable to in-context persona shifts.”

Coaching procedures may also induce sudden modifications. As an illustration, fine-tuning a mannequin on a slim job like producing insecure code can result in a broader “emergent misalignment” that extends past the unique job. Even well-intentioned coaching changes can backfire. In April 2025, a modification to the reinforcement studying from human suggestions (RLHF) course of unintentionally made OpenAI’s GPT-4o overly sycophantic, inflicting it to validate dangerous behaviors.

How persona vectors work

The brand new analysis builds on the idea that high-level traits, comparable to truthfulness or secrecy, are encoded as linear instructions inside a mannequin’s “activation area” (the inner, high-dimensional illustration of data embedded inside the mannequin’s weights). The researchers systematized the method of discovering these instructions, which they name “persona vectors.” In line with the paper, their technique for extracting persona vectors is automated and “could be utilized to any persona trait of curiosity, given solely a natural-language description.”

The method works by way of an automatic pipeline. It begins with a easy description of a trait, comparable to “evil.” The pipeline then generates pairs of contrasting system prompts (e.g., “You’re an evil AI” vs. “You’re a useful AI”) together with a set of analysis questions. The mannequin generates responses beneath each the constructive and damaging prompts. The persona vector is then calculated by taking the distinction within the common inner activations between the responses that exhibit the trait and people that don’t. This isolates the precise path within the mannequin’s weights that corresponds to that persona trait.

Placing persona vectors to make use of

In a collection of experiments with open fashions, comparable to Qwen 2.5-7B-Instruct and Llama-3.1-8B-Instruct, the researchers demonstrated a number of sensible functions for persona vectors.

First, by projecting a mannequin’s inner state onto a persona vector, builders can monitor and predict the way it will behave earlier than it generates a response. The paper states, “We present that each supposed and unintended finetuning-induced persona shifts strongly correlate with activation modifications alongside corresponding persona vectors.” This permits for early detection and mitigation of undesirable behavioral shifts throughout fine-tuning.

Persona vectors additionally enable for direct intervention to curb undesirable behaviors at inference time by way of a course of the researchers name “steering.” One strategy is “post-hoc steering,” the place builders subtract the persona vector from the mannequin’s activations throughout inference to mitigate a nasty trait. The researchers discovered that whereas efficient, post-hoc steering can typically degrade the mannequin’s efficiency on different duties. 

A extra novel technique is “preventative steering,” the place the mannequin is proactively steered towards the undesirable persona throughout fine-tuning. This counterintuitive strategy primarily “vaccinates” the mannequin towards studying the unhealthy trait from the coaching information, canceling out the fine-tuning stress whereas higher preserving its basic capabilities.

A key utility for enterprises is utilizing persona vectors to display information earlier than fine-tuning. The researchers developed a metric referred to as “projection distinction,” which measures how a lot a given coaching dataset will push the mannequin’s persona towards a specific trait. This metric is very predictive of how the mannequin’s habits will shift after coaching, permitting builders to flag and filter problematic datasets earlier than utilizing them in coaching.

For corporations that fine-tune open-source fashions on proprietary or third-party information (together with information generated by different fashions), persona vectors present a direct option to monitor and mitigate the chance of inheriting hidden, undesirable traits. The power to display information proactively is a robust software for builders, enabling the identification of problematic samples that will not be instantly obvious as dangerous. 

The analysis discovered that this method can discover points that different strategies miss, noting, “This means that the tactic surfaces problematic samples that will evade LLM-based detection.” For instance, their technique was capable of catch some dataset examples that weren’t clearly problematic to the human eye, and that an LLM decide wasn’t capable of flag.

In a weblog put up, Anthropic steered that they are going to use this method to enhance future generations of Claude. “Persona vectors give us some deal with on the place fashions purchase these personalities, how they fluctuate over time, and the way we are able to higher management them,” they write. Anthropic has launched the code for computing persona vectors, monitoring and steering mannequin habits, and vetting coaching datasets. Builders of AI functions can make the most of these instruments to transition from merely reacting to undesirable habits to proactively designing fashions with a extra secure and predictable persona.
